9: Darvaza Gas Crater: 

Known as the "Door to Hell," the Darvaza Gas Crater is a mesmerizing natural wonder born from a Soviet-era drilling mishap. This colossal crater has been ablaze for decades, emitting an eerie glow that punctuates the stark beauty of the surrounding desert. The perpetual flames create a surreal and captivating spectacle, turning the crater into an enigmatic beacon in Turkmenistan's vast and otherworldly landscape.

2: Merv: 

Merv, an ancient jewel along the Silk Road, has earned the esteemed status of a UNESCO World Heritage Site. Nestled within the expansive Karakum Desert, this city's well-preserved historical remnants unfold a captivating journey into the past. Merv's archaeological treasures include ancient fortifications, grandiose palaces, and intricate mosques, providing a vivid snapshot of the city's former glory as a major center of trade and culture. As visitors traverse the ruins, they embark on a historical odyssey, immersing themselves in the remnants of a city that once thrived as a crossroads of civilizations, leaving an indelible mark on Turkmenistan's cultural legacy.
